A distillate fired industrial boiler rated at 60 million BTU/hr uses 2 million gallons per year of 0.25% sulfur distillate. What are its emissions of nitrogen oxides (NOx), SO2 and formaldehyde? Emission factors of air pollutants for distillate combustion in an industrial boiler are given below. NOX Pollutant Emission factor (lb/103 gallon 20 * SO2 142S* PM 10 2 CO 5 VOCs 0.2 Benzene 0.1863 Formaldehyde 1.7261 Cadmium Chromium(VI) *S= %S in fuel 0.0015 0.0002
